Javascript 如何显示JSON单级菜单

Javascript 如何显示JSON单级菜单,javascript,jquery,ajax,json,Javascript,Jquery,Ajax,Json,我有一个json文件,其中包含来自如下特定文件夹的所有链接图像 ["http://img1.png","http://img2.png","http://img3.png","http://img4.png"] 我想用这个创建一个列表,但我不知道如何创建。 有人能帮我举个小例子吗 谢谢var url=[”http://img1.png","http://img2.png","http://img3.png","http://img4.png"]; var ul=$(“”); 对于(var i=

我有一个json文件,其中包含来自如下特定文件夹的所有链接图像

["http://img1.png","http://img2.png","http://img3.png","http://img4.png"]
我想用这个创建一个
列表,但我不知道如何创建。 有人能帮我举个小例子吗

谢谢

var url=[”http://img1.png","http://img2.png","http://img3.png","http://img4.png"];
var ul=$(“
    ”); 对于(var i=0;i”); li.附录(ul);
    $('假设已将其解析为数组
    arr
    ,则可以执行以下操作:

    var ul = $('<ul/>').append(arr.map(function(i) {
        return '<li><img src="'+i+'" /></li>';
    }).join());
    
    var ul=$('
      ').append(arr.map)(函数(i){ 返回“
    • ”; }).join());
    其中
    arr
    [”http://img1.png","http://img2.png","http://img3.png","http://img4.png“]

    试试这个

    var arr_images = ["http://img1.png","http://img2.png","http://img3.png","http://img4.png"];
    
    var html = '<ul>';
    for(var i=0; i<arr_images.length; i++)
    {
       var img_url = arr_images[i];
       html += '<li>';
       html += '<img src="'+img_url+'" />';
       html += '</li>';
    }
    html += '</ul>';
    
    document.getElementById('your_div_id').innerHTML = html;
    
    var arr_images=[”http://img1.png","http://img2.png","http://img3.png","http://img4.png"];
    var html='
      ';
      对于(var i=0;i使用json您可以连接

      $.post(“http://shared1.ad-lister.co.uk/GetImagesList.aspx?contextId=c9d56aca-506c-40be-9068-037d0fba62c9&文件夹=_设计/汽车品牌”,功能(json){
      var html='
        '; for(var i=0;i
      您可以通过jQuery API使用函数

      var json = ["http://img1.png","http://img2.png","http://img3.png","http://img4.png"]
      var div ='<ul>';
      json.map(function (text){ 
          div += '<li><img src="'+ text + '" /></li>'
        });
      div += '</ul>'
      
      $("containerSelector").append(div)
      
      var json=[”http://img1.png","http://img2.png","http://img3.png","http://img4.png"]
      var div='
        '; json.map(函数(文本){ div+='
      • ' }); div+='
      ' $(“containerSelector”).append(div)
      如何将URL var与我的json链接连接..因为我的json类似于http://etc.com/getimages.aspx?getfolder==design/cars,并且只返回这个[“例如通过AJAX加载它。嗨@Adrian我已经用AJAX请求回答了你的问题这是有效的:…我也在这里更新了相同的代码..请检查它
      $.post("http://shared1.ad-lister.co.uk/GetImagesList.aspx?contextId=c9d56aca-506c-40be-9068-037d0fba62c9&Folder=_design/car-marques", function (json) {
      
          var html = '<ul>';
          for (var i = 0; i < json.length; i++) {
              html += '<li><img src="'+json[i]+'" /></li>';
          }
          html += '</ul>';
      
          $('.contents').html(html);
      });
      
      var json = ["http://img1.png","http://img2.png","http://img3.png","http://img4.png"]
      var div ='<ul>';
      json.map(function (text){ 
          div += '<li><img src="'+ text + '" /></li>'
        });
      div += '</ul>'
      
      $("containerSelector").append(div)